Spring Valley is 9-1 against Glenwood City since May of 2017, and they'll have a chance to extend that success on Thursday. The Spring Valley Cardinals will head out on the road to square off against the Glenwood City Hilltoppers at 5:00 p.m. Glenwood City took a loss in their last contest and will be looking to turn the tables on Spring Valley, who comes in off a win.
Last Thursday, everything went Spring Valley's way against Elmwood/Plum City as Spring Valley made off with a 9-1 victory. The win was just what Spring Valley needed coming off of an 8-1 defeat in their prior matchup.
Meanwhile, Glenwood City fell victim to a rough 12-2 loss at the hands of Elk Mound on Monday. That's two games in a row now that Glenwood City has lost by exactly ten runs.
Glenwood City saw four different players step up and record at least one hit. One of them was Peyton Theune, who scored a run while going 1-for-2.
The victory got Spring Valley back to even at 1-1. As for Glenwood City, their defeat dropped their record down to 0-2.
Spring Valley came up short against Glenwood City when the teams last played back in May of 2023, falling 10-7. Can Spring Valley avenge their loss or is history doomed to repeat itself? We'll find out soon enough.
